    Job Description:
    The Project Manager, Merchandising is responsible for managing the internal processes and systems for the development, creation, and delivery of promotional displays. This role is responsible for following internal procedures, ensuring project deliverables are completed on-time, and coordinating/following up with cross-functional partners to ensure they complete assigned tasks. The role provides key support for the Merchandising team Business Leaders to deliver against merchandising goals.
    Main Duties:
    Being proficient at entering necessary project information into Hershey s Accolade system
    Consistently monitoring projects to ensure all key deliverables are assigned and moving forward
    Coordinating and following up with multiple cross-functional stakeholders to ensure they provide key deliverables
    Managing project timelines and financials against key milestones and targets
    Typical Day:
    Create/enter new projects into Accolade as needed
    Check existing projects in Accolade to ensure tasks are on schedule
    Follow-up with multiple cross-functional partners to ensure they are aware of and perform tasks related to projects
    Coordinate information and documents (e.g. P&Ls, spec packets, etc.) for projects and prepare for Governance meetings to gain approval
    Top Three Technical Skills:
    Time Management
    Organization/Multi-tasking
    Cross-functional and interpersonal communication

    What do you foresee as being the biggest challenge in this position?
    Multi-tasking. Coordinating 10-15 projects at a given time, each with different deliverables and timelines.

    Training
    How long is training? Up to a week
    What is involved? Individual meetings with various cross-functional partners (Finance, Packaging, Supply Chain) to understand their role within the display creation process. 1-2 hour meeting with Accolade subject matter expert to learn basic system navigation. Individual meetings with Merchandising Business Leaders to understand their roles and how projects are managed. Various online tools and tutorials are also available to explain processes and Accolade navigation.
